The cabinet or bench oven is used to describe small batch equipment. Wisconsin Oven offers various sizes in two models, the SBH and the CB.
The SBH or Heavy Duty Bench is designed for a heavy-duty cycle and is offered in thirty-six (36) sizes. The SBH is perfect for long dwell times at high temperatures and high volume production. The SBH has unequalled air volume and heat input. The SBH is offered in either electric or natural gas heat. The SBH or Heavy Duty Bench is designed for 650°F with a high temperature option for 1,000°F operation. The SBH is a laboratory oven with a floor stand and a structural rack and shelf assembly, plus many other options to choose from. E-mail us regarding your application, and we will be glad to fit you with the bench model that best suits your needs.
The Cabinet Batch (CB) is offered in three sizes (8, 27, & 36 cubic feet), in two temperature ranges (500°F/260°C and 800°F/427°C) and in two fuels, gas or electric.
The CB series oven provides horizontal air flow at maximum capacity through the work chamber, ensuring excellent temperature uniformity. The exterior is designed for a clean, sleek appearance suitable for any Laboratory environment, but the interior design and construction features are heavy-duty, making the CB series oven ideal for any industrial application. |

Cabinet Ovens
Gruenberg Oven Company designs and manufactures a complete line of standard as well as custom cabinet ovens to accommodate a variety of thermal processing applications. Cabinet ovens are designed to reach temperatures up to 1200° Fahrenheit and are ideally suited for annealing, aging, core hardening, drying, preheating, curing, and component testing. And, with additional options, they can also be used for applications such as epoxy, plastic, and rubber curing; paint and varnish baking; textile drying; and sterilizing.
Features:
Heavy-duty, fully-welded, structural steel frame
CHIL construction ensures minimal heat transfer from oven chamber to the exterior
Side and back walls are removable for easy clean-up and maintenance
Doors are constructed using a structural steel frame to ensure sealing integrity
Insulation is moisture-proof, non-combustible, non-settling, and asbestos-free
Energy-efficient, Incoloy® sheathed, seamless tubular heaters are standard
Heating elements are suspended in the plenum adjacent to, but separate from the process chamber so there is no radiant influence on the work in process |

Stuffing Box Packings (Gland Packings) are machine-braided cords of different materials, used for sealing rotating shafts in pumps, ventilators and fittings. Packing sections are laid round the shaft in circles and then compressed with the gland. For dynamic applications, the compression must be so adjusted that a certain minor amount of leakage between packing and shaft may emerge. Harmful dry running is prevented thus and the leakage is dissipated or returned. Various materials and material combinations are used according to the individual case of application. Special lubricants are incorporated into the braiding to improve running properties.

FAG housing and bearing units have successfully been used in machinery, installations and equipment.
FAG bearing housings are usually made of greycast iron.
As a rule, the bearing seats in the housings are machined in such a way that the bearings can be
displaced, i.e. they are of the floating type. All outer surfaces of FAG housings and housing parts are provided with a universal coat of paint (colour RAL 7031, bluish grey).
Depending on the operating conditions, the bearing housings can be sealed with rubbing seals, non-rubbing seals, and combinations of both. |

Radial insert ball bearings are single row, rady-to-fit units comprising a solid outer ring, an inner ring extended on one or both sides, cages made from plastic or sheet steel and P, R, L or T seals. Bearings with an inner ring extended on both sides undergo less tilting of the inner ring and therefore run more smoothly.
The outer ring has a crowned or cylindrical outside surface. In conjunction with an INA housing matched to the bearing type, bearings with a crowned outside surface compensate for shaft misalignments; see Compensation of misalignments.
They are located on the shaft by means of an eccentric locking collar, grub screws in the inner ring, an adapter sleeve, drive slot or fit. Radial insert ball bearings are particularly easy to fit, suitable for drawn shafts of grade h6 to h9 and, with a few exceptions, can be relubricated.
Some series with an eccentric locking collar and with grub screws in the inner ring are also available with an inch size bore.
